News Casting Announced for Free NYC Reading of Steven Levenson's Immortality/Technology Project Colt Coeur’s Play Hotel reading series will continue Sept. 24 at 7 PM with a free staged reading of Steven Levenson’s Immortality/Technology Project at the CoCo Studio in Manhattan.

Directed by Adrienne Campbell-Holt, the cast will feature Katya Campbell, Ato Essandoh, Erin Felgar, Kate Cullen Roberts, Caleb Scott, Matt Stadelmann and Joe Tippett.

Colt Coeur is a NY-based ensemble of actors, designers, playwrights and directors dedicated to making original, story-driven, aggressively visceral theatre 

Steven Levenson's plays include The Language of Trees (Roundabout Underground), Seven Minutes in Heaven (Colt Coeur @HERE Arts Center; Emerging America Festival/Huntington Theater Company), Retreat (Edinburgh Fringe Festival), Almost Stuck and Girls Day. His work has been seen and developed by Roundabout, Lincoln Center Theater, Manhattan Theatre Club, Atlantic Theater Company, MCC Theater, Ars Nova, Ensemble Studio Theatre, Berkshire Theatre Festival and Oregon Shakespeare Festival. His plays are published by Dramatists Play Service and Playscripts. A graduate of Brown University and the 2010 Artist in Residence at Ars Nova, Levenson is currently working on commissions for Roundabout, Lincoln Center, MCC and Ars Nova. He is a member of the MCC Playwrights' Coalition and a founding member of Colt Coeur.
